"Set inside the Boulevard Mall, the 60,000-square-foot family fun center John’s Incredible Pizza has retooled its massive buffet into a technology-powered, all-you-can-eat table-service restaurant to operate safely during the coronavirus pandemic. Customers now order via the John’s app — developed by John’s in-house operations and IT team — and all food is brought to diners’ tables. The buffet-style offerings still include pastas, pizzas, fried chicken, a 40-plus-item salad bar, soups, potatoes and desserts, while the entertainment side features more than 100 games, full-size amusement park rides and attractions such as bumper cars, a spinning twister ride and a swinging plane. The restaurant is open 11 a.m. to 9 p.m. Sunday through Thursday and 11 a.m. to 10 p.m. Friday and Saturday, and it joins other Las Vegas buffets that have reopened." - Susan Stapleton
